Mastering Amazon RDS: The Ultimate Guide to Managed Relational Databases - Podcast

Amazon Relational Database Service (Amazon RDS) is a managed service that makes it easier to set up, operate, and scale a relational database in the cloud. It provides cost-efficient and resizable capacity while automating time-consuming administration tasks such as hardware provisioning, database setup, patching, and backups. This frees you to focus on your applications to give them the fast performance, high availability, security, and compatibility they need.
